The power of GIS enables organizations, both private and public to take advantage of their geographic data. It is an essential tool that can help shape the world around us.
GIS describes the category of software that provides users the ability to consume geographic data in order to analyze and view that data geographically. From plotting an address to see where in the city it is, to tracking real time flood stage data from remote sensors to provide realโtime view of conditions on the ground during a flooding event, the software used is GIS.

Another example is of an innovative solution isย ArcGIS Hub. A unique combination of location intelligence and spatial analytics, the innovative product helps communities to direct their open data toward deeper citizen engagement, with apps, data, events, and meaningful collaboration focused on specific civic initiatives. This technology lets citizens, businesses, academic institutions, and nongovernmental organizations (NGOs) take advantage of their governments’ spatial analytics capabilities to collaborate on data-driven policy initiatives.
